Comprehensive Case Study: Makeup Artist Website Development

Introduction

The makeup artist website, developed by V1 Technologies for Tripti Rastogi, a renowned makeup artist with seven years of experience, exemplifies a successful digital transformation. This case study delves into the project's lifecycle, from initial conception to post-launch maintenance, highlighting the challenges faced, technologies used, and the impact of SEO on business growth.

Initial Ideation and Requirements Gathering

Client Vision

Tripti envisioned a website that not only showcased her portfolio but also offered a seamless user experience for potential clients to book appointments and inquire about services. The goal was to create an online presence that reflected her brand's elegance and professionalism.

Requirements Gathering

Our team conducted several meetings with Tripti to understand her needs. Key requirements included:

  • A visually appealing design
  • User-friendly navigation
  • Mobile responsiveness
  • Integration of booking and contact forms
  • SEO optimization

Design and Architecture

Design Phase

The design phase focused on creating a modern, elegant look that resonated with Tripti’s brand. Our designers crafted several mockups, incorporating feedback from Tripti to ensure alignment with her vision.

Key Design Elements
  • Color Scheme: A palette that reflected sophistication and beauty.
  • Typography: Elegant fonts that enhanced readability.
  • Imagery: High-quality images of Tripti’s work to attract and engage visitors.

Architectural Planning

The website's architecture was planned to ensure scalability and performance. Key considerations included:

  • CMS Selection: WordPress was chosen for its flexibility and ease of use.
  • Responsive Design: Ensuring the site performed well on all devices.
  • SEO-Friendly Structure: Clean URL structures and fast loading times were prioritized.

Development Phases

Front-End Development

Our front-end team focused on creating a responsive and visually appealing interface. Technologies used included HTML5, CSS3, and JavaScript. Special attention was given to:

  • Responsive Design: Using Bootstrap to ensure the site was mobile-friendly.
  • Animations: Subtle animations to enhance user engagement without compromising load times.

Back-End Development

The back-end development focused on creating a robust and scalable infrastructure. Key technologies and tools included:

  • WordPress CMS: Custom theme development to meet specific design requirements.
  • PHP and MySQL: For database management and server-side scripting.
  • Plugins: Custom plugins were developed for booking forms and contact management.

Testing Procedures

Functional Testing

Comprehensive testing was conducted to ensure all functionalities worked as expected. This included testing:

  • Forms: Booking and contact forms.
  • Navigation: Smooth and intuitive navigation across the site.
  • Responsiveness: Consistent performance on various devices and screen sizes.

Performance Testing

Load testing was performed to ensure the site could handle high traffic volumes. Tools like Google PageSpeed Insights were used to optimize performance.

User Acceptance Testing (UAT)

The client reviewed the site, providing feedback which was incorporated before final deployment. This ensured the website met all client expectations.

Deployment Strategies

Pre-Deployment

Before going live, the site was hosted on a staging server. This allowed for final reviews and adjustments.

Deployment

The website was deployed using a phased approach to minimize downtime. Key steps included:

  • Backup: Comprehensive backup of the existing site.
  • Migration: Transferring files and databases to the live server.
  • DNS Propagation: Ensuring smooth transition without affecting user access.

Post-Launch Maintenance and Support

Initial Monitoring

Post-launch, the site was closely monitored for any issues. Our team provided immediate support to resolve any bugs or performance issues.

Ongoing Maintenance

Regular updates and maintenance were scheduled to keep the site secure and up-to-date. This included:

  • Content Updates: Adding new content and images as provided by the client.
  • Security Updates: Regular updates to plugins and CMS to prevent vulnerabilities.
  • Performance Optimization: Periodic performance checks and optimizations.

Unique Challenges and Solutions

Challenge: Integrating a Custom Booking System

Tripti required a custom booking system tailored to her unique needs. Off-the-shelf solutions did not meet all requirements.

Solution: Our developers built a custom plugin that allowed clients to book appointments directly through the website, with options to specify services, dates, and times. This was seamlessly integrated with Tripti’s existing workflow.

Challenge: Ensuring Mobile Responsiveness

Given the significant number of users accessing websites through mobile devices, ensuring a seamless mobile experience was crucial.

Solution: We employed a mobile-first design approach, using responsive frameworks like Bootstrap to ensure the site was optimized for various devices.

Challenge: SEO Optimization

Tripti's goal was to reach a wider audience and improve her search engine rankings.

Solution: Our SEO team implemented on-page and off-page SEO strategies, including:

  • Keyword Optimization: Identifying and incorporating relevant keywords throughout the site.
  • Content Strategy: Creating high-quality, engaging content that attracted and retained visitors.
  • Backlink Strategy: Building high-quality backlinks to improve domain authority.

SEO Impact

Our SEO efforts yielded significant results. Post-launch, the website saw a substantial increase in traffic and improved search engine rankings.

Specific SEO Strategies Implemented

  • On-Page SEO: Optimized meta tags, headings, and content for target keywords.
  • Technical SEO: Improved site speed, mobile-friendliness, and secure connections (HTTPS).
  • Content Marketing: Regular blog posts and updates to keep the site fresh and relevant.

Outcomes

  • Increased Traffic: A 40% increase in organic traffic within three months.
  • Improved Rankings: The website ranked on the first page for several targeted keywords.
  • Enhanced Engagement: Increased user engagement metrics, including lower bounce rates and higher average session durations.

Collaborative Efforts

The success of this project was due to the collaborative efforts of the V1 Technologies team and the client. Regular communication and feedback loops ensured that the project stayed on track and met all requirements.

Project Management Techniques

We employed Agile methodologies to manage the project efficiently. Key practices included:

  • Sprint Planning: Dividing the project into manageable sprints with specific goals.
  • Daily Standups: Regular meetings to track progress and address any issues promptly.
  • Client Reviews: Frequent client reviews to ensure alignment and gather feedback.

Lessons Learned

  1. Effective Communication: Regular and clear communication with the client is crucial for understanding requirements and making timely adjustments.
  2. Flexibility: Being adaptable to changes and feedback helps in delivering a product that truly meets client needs.
  3. Continuous Improvement: Post-launch maintenance and SEO are ongoing processes that require regular attention and updates.

Conclusion

The makeup artist website for Tripti Rastogi stands as a testament to V1 Technologies' expertise in delivering high-quality, custom web solutions. From initial ideation to post-launch support, our team successfully navigated various challenges to create a website that not only met but exceeded client expectations. The significant impact of our SEO strategies further underscores our capability to drive business growth through digital solutions.